New album recording update
Monday, 26 April 2010

Susan WongAm happy to let you all know that I have finished recording my latest album. Teaming up again with the guys from Lausanne (Switzerland) and with my producer Adrien Z, we have put together another "unexpected" music creation. The song list is a compilation from late 60s and early 70s extending to one of the biggest hits of  2009.  Thanks to the "unthinkable" and daring ideas from Adrien, together with my music arranger and lead guitarist, Ignacio, I am hoping for another surprise to  you all.

Returning back to the same studio for recording as 511 brought back a certain level of comfort. Being back to a known environment made recording a lot smoother and easier. The weather was great, clear blue skies, the sun, and a refreshing cool breeze, but spending more than 12 hours a day in the studio, I did not get much of the fresh Swiss air.

ImageEverything went smoothly, from the day of arrival and to the very last minute of recording. Hence it is inevitable that something not so smooth should arise. I finished recording on the day the Iceland volanoe erupted. Listening to the very early morning news on the Thursday sent some bad vibes. The ash was spreading so quickly that I decided to make other travel plans. Instead of staying on a few more days, I decided to leave that evening back to Hong Kong, I was very lucky to get the last seat on the last flight back to Hong Kong as the next day, most airports from Europe have closed. To me, my travels always involves some hiccups, but this was one unforseeable incident that I was lucky to get out of.

I hope you all look forward to my next release and I will update you on the song list when I am "allowed" to. Perhaps you may give me a suggestion to my next album's title.
 
And last but not least, I will be releasing my own special line of headphones of which I collaborated in the sound engineering and design of. This headphone, which the sound have been tested with my vocals, will be released in June this year. I will closely update this release and will post some photos of my design.

My NEW Album is coming soon
Friday, 27 March 2009

ImageThis album has taken more than a year to prepare and I hope that you will find a change in both my music and vocal direction.
 
Having made my previous album in Nashville USA, I took the liberty to record my new album in Geneva, Switzerland. Actually, more of a coincidence, as the producer, Adrien Z, whom I had a very strong interest to work with, lived in Geneva,
 
Very talented! He brought my music ideas to life. He was able to transform the songs I want to sing into the styling which I dare tried.
 
I made my way to Geneva last year in September to meet with him for the first time, and the skeletal structure of my demos were made.  I guess I took a "more hands on" approach with this album, more than any of  the previous ones, as I felt the need to voice out my persona, be more individualistic and independent for my work.Together with the guitarist, also from Geneva, we jammed a few sessions and share a lot of ideas and possibilities, ," accapella" style as they would say.
 
I am looking forward to releasing a few bits and pieces of my album in the coming weeks, and let you share the harvesting of the work and efforts I put in this past year!
